Why Trust Signals Matter Before Checking Out

Of course, when a celebrity-endorsed product starts getting attention, the online search begins. But here is where Malaysian shoppers need to be more careful.

Some may be from official stores. Some may be from authorised sellers. Others may look similar but offer very little clarity on authenticity, warranty or after-sales support.

That matters, especially for products like makeup, skincare, eyewear and electronic lifestyle gadgets.

For beauty and skincare, authenticity is important because these products go directly on the skin. For eyewear, quality matters because frames and lenses are used daily. For hair tools and smart home gadgets, warranty and proper after-sales support can make a big difference after purchase.

So while the excitement may start with a favourite star, the final decision should come down to trust.

Before checking out, Malaysian shoppers should look for:

  • Official brand stores or authorised sellers
  • Authenticity guarantees
  • Verified store badges
  • Secure payment options
  • Clear customer reviews
  • Return policies
  • Warranty or after-sales support, especially for gadgets and electronics

The smartest fans are not just asking, “Is this the product my favourite star endorsed?” They are also asking, “Am I buying it from the right place?”
